Welcome to Rowan University’s Career Site

A top 100 national public research institution, Rowan University offers bachelor’s through doctoral and professional programs in person and online to 22,000 students through its main campus in Glassboro, N.J., its medical school campuses in Camden and Stratford, and five others. The University has earned national recognition for innovation, commitment to high-quality, affordable education, and developing public-private partnerships. A Carnegie-classified R2 (high research activity) institution, Rowan has been recognized as the fourth fastest-growing public research university, as reported by The Chronicle of Higher Education. Senior Grant Analyst – Pre & Post Award Grant Administration (PSS2), Department of Biomedical Sciences (CMSRU)

Apply now Job no: 500032
Work type: Regular Full-Time
Location: Camden, New Jersey
Categories: Professional

PURPOSE:

The Senior Grant Analyst is responsible for providing proposal and financial support services to meet the needs of the Department and its Faculty. The Senior Grant Analyst reports directly to the Assistant Director in CMSRU Department of Biomedical Sciences (BMS). The Senior Grant Analyst will focus heavily on compliance, reporting, and variance analysis functions. The Senior Grant Analyst will interface with various University departments such as Office of Sponsored Programs Pre and Post Award, HR, Payroll, Purchasing & Procurement, and Accounts Payable.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• PRE-AWARD GRANT ADMINISTRATION:
    • Initiate and manage external grant proposals in Cayuse.
    • Preparation of proposals to external sponsors.
    • Develop proposal budget.
    • Insure administrative and regulatory compliance.
    • Create and upload grant submission materials into Cayuse.
    • Aiding with preparation of sub-awards, consulting agreements, and related documents
    • Work with the Office of Sponsored Programs, Pre-Award Staff to ensure timely and complete submission of proposals. 
    • Complete other duties as assigned by BMS Director.

REQUIRMENTS - EDUCATION:

Bachelor's degree in accounting or finance from an accredited College or University. Advanced degree or certification is preferred but not required.

EXPERIENCE:

Minimum 3 years of professional experience in an institution of higher education or not for profit industry preferred.  Applicants who do not possess the required education may substitute experience on a year for year basis. Experience with grants.gov, NSF FastLane, Proposal Central as well as other sponsor proposal systems. The Senior Grant Analyst should have a comprehensive understanding of research administration with in-depth knowledge of OMB Uniform Guidance and other research regulatory requirements.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ITY:

  • Proficiency in spreadsheet (Excel), and accounting software (preferably Ellucian Banner)
  • Strong work ethic with a defined sense of urgency, ownership, and accountability for job duties.
  • Ability to organize assigned work, analyze problems, and develop appropriate work methods.
  • Ability to handle sensitive and confidential information.
